So I took the PVM apart and wanted to do a recap, and found the neck board connector plastic (what is it called?) was partly melted and shattered.. see https://imgur.com/a/3CF5uAC. Also one of the capacitor (the 250v one) was bad, so I replaced that. Now I don't know where to find replacement for that green plastic piece, is it ok to still use it although it's partly broken, so some pins would be exposed? Also the black silicon seal was hard to remove, it seems someone has tried to fix this earlier and put too much seal on it.
